Understanding GI Cancer Surgery
Gastrointestinal (GI) cancer surgery involves the surgical treatment of cancers affecting the digestive system, including the esophagus, stomach, liver, pancreas, gallbladder, small intestine, colon, and rectum. Types of GI Cancers We Treat
Common GI Cancers Requiring Surgery:
- Stomach Cancer (Gastric Cancer) - Partial or total gastrectomy
- Colorectal Cancer - Advanced colorectal surgery
- Liver Cancer (Hepatocellular Carcinoma) - Liver resection surgery
- Pancreatic Cancer - Whipple procedure, distal pancreatectomy
- Esophageal Cancer - Esophagectomy procedures
- Gallbladder Cancer - Cholecystectomy with lymph node dissection
- Small Bowel Cancer - Segmental resection
- Gastrointestinal Stromal Tumors (GIST) - Precise tumor resection

📞 Call (+91) 98982 69932When is GI Cancer Surgery Needed?
Surgery is Recommended When:
- Early-stage cancers suitable for curative resection
- Localized tumors without distant metastasis
- Symptomatic cancers causing obstruction or bleeding
- Resectable liver metastases from colorectal cancer
- Preventive surgery for high-risk precancerous conditions
- Palliative procedures to relieve symptoms
- Part of multimodal treatment with chemotherapy/radiation

Common Symptoms Requiring Evaluation:
- Persistent abdominal pain or discomfort
- Unexplained weight loss (>5% in 6 months)
- Changes in bowel habits lasting >2 weeks
- Blood in stool or black, tarry stools
- Difficulty swallowing or persistent heartburn
- Persistent nausea, vomiting, or loss of appetite
- Yellowing of skin or eyes (jaundice)
- Persistent fatigue or weakness
- Family history of GI cancers

Our Cancer Surgery Procedures
Stomach Cancer Surgery
Dr. Bhavsar performs advanced gastric cancer surgeries including subtotal gastrectomy, total gastrectomy, and lymph node dissection using minimally invasive techniques when possible.
Colorectal Cancer Surgery
Comprehensive colorectal cancer treatment including right hemicolectomy, left hemicolectomy, anterior resection, and abdominoperineal resection with optimal oncological outcomes.
Liver Cancer Surgery
Expert liver cancer surgery including partial hepatectomy, segmentectomy, and complex liver resections for primary and secondary liver cancers.
Pancreatic Cancer Surgery
Advanced pancreatic cancer procedures including Whipple procedure (pancreaticoduodenectomy), distal pancreatectomy, and central pancreatectomy using minimally invasive approaches when feasible.
Recovery Timeline After GI Cancer Surgery
| Timeline | Robotic/Laparoscopic | Open Surgery | Key Milestones |
|---|---|---|---|
| Day 1-2 | Early mobilization | Gradual mobilization | Pain management, wound care |
| Day 3-5 | Liquid diet start | IV fluids continue | Bowel function return |
| Week 1 | Hospital discharge | Continued monitoring | Soft diet progression |
| Week 2-4 | Return to light activities | Gradual diet advance | Follow-up visits, pathology results |
| Month 2-3 | Normal diet, full activity | Recovery assessment | Adjuvant therapy planning if needed |
| Ongoing | Regular cancer surveillance | Long-term follow-up | Cancer monitoring, lifestyle support |
Cost of GI Cancer Surgery in Ahmedabad
The cost of GI cancer surgery varies based on the type of cancer, surgical approach, hospital stay duration, and post-operative care requirements:
| Procedure Type | Laparoscopic Surgery | Robotic Surgery | Open Surgery |
|---|---|---|---|
| Gastric Cancer Surgery | ₹2,50,000 - ₹4,50,000 | ₹4,50,000 - ₹7,50,000 | ₹2,00,000 - ₹4,00,000 |
| Colorectal Cancer Surgery | ₹2,00,000 - ₹4,00,000 | ₹4,00,000 - ₹6,50,000 | ₹1,50,000 - ₹3,50,000 |
| Liver Cancer Surgery | ₹3,00,000 - ₹6,00,000 | ₹5,50,000 - ₹9,00,000 | ₹2,50,000 - ₹5,50,000 |
| Pancreatic Cancer Surgery | ₹4,00,000 - ₹7,50,000 | ₹6,50,000 - ₹12,00,000 | ₹3,50,000 - ₹7,00,000 |
*Costs include surgeon fees, hospital charges, anesthesia, and standard post-operative care. Insurance coverage and government schemes may significantly reduce out-of-pocket expenses.

Pre-Surgery Preparation
Before GI cancer surgery, comprehensive evaluation includes:
- Cancer Staging: CT scans, MRI, PET scans to determine cancer extent
- Functional Assessment: Cardiac, pulmonary, and nutritional evaluation
- Blood Tests: Complete blood count, liver function, tumor markers
- Endoscopic Evaluation: Advanced endoscopy for tumor assessment
- Multidisciplinary Planning: Team approach for optimal treatment strategy
- Nutrition Optimization: Pre-operative nutritional support when needed
- Informed Consent: Detailed discussion of risks, benefits, and alternatives
Post-Surgery Care & Follow-up
Comprehensive post-operative care includes:
- Immediate Care: ICU monitoring for complex procedures
- Pain Management: Multimodal approach for optimal comfort
- Nutritional Support: Gradual diet progression and supplements
- Pathology Review: Detailed cancer staging and margin assessment
- Adjuvant Therapy: Coordination with medical oncologists when needed
- Surveillance: Regular follow-up with imaging and tumor markers
- Rehabilitation: Support for return to normal activities
